Laughing, coughing, sneezing... if these everyday moments have started feeling a little less carefree and a little more leak-prone, you're not alone. And despite what you've been told, the answer isn't just "do more Kegels."In this conversation, movement teacher and pelvic floor expert Lauren Ohayon shares why the pelvic floor doesn't just "squeeze." It dances, responds to gravity, and works as part of a whole-body system involving your breath, core, and nervous system. We talk about why menopause brings new pelvic floor challenges (spoiler: it's not just estrogen), how belly-gripping and chronic tension patterns create downstream problems, and why feeling safe in your body is foundational to pelvic floor health.If you've been living with light leakage, pain with intimacy, or that uncomfortable feeling of prolapse, this episode offers a refreshing, shame-free perspective on what's happening and practical ways to support your pelvic floor that go way beyond squeezing.About Lauren: Lauren Ohayon is a longtime movement teacher who has spent decades helping people reconnect with their bodies. After a back injury in her early 20s led her deep into biomechanics and anatomy, she created Restore Your Core, an online functional strength program focused on core and pelvic floor health.
